I must admit being hardware savvy, I did not realize drives even came in 1.8" Well you learn something everyday I guess. Well my primary reason for purchasing this drive was to revive an old Zune media player I received from a friend. The sort-of famous error 5 message kept appearing after I recharged the Zune after it remained dormant for such a long time.

Well I did some research, and found out that only certain drives work with this type of Zune player. I was hesitant to buy a full fledged 120Gb dive since I don't have a large music collection. So I picked this out because it was significantly cheaper than the 120Gb drives. A do-it-yourself repair that didn't take much time, and a little recharge I got the player to boot up. It asked me to connect to the Zune Software then voila, The Zune works perfectly fine.

In short, this 1.8" drive works perfectly fine with a Zune 120 media player. I cannot testify as to how long it will last, but at least I learned something.
